MED 585 - Advanced Topics at the Intersection of Health and Planning

★ 3 (fi 6)(EITHER, 3-0-0)

Exploring the importance of urban and regional planning to create communities supportive of health in the context of the contemporary epidemics of non-communicable diseases. Variable content course which may be repeated if topic(s) vary.
